asp.net-mvc - 操作过滤器异常

标签 asp.net-mvc asp.net-mvc-3

我想对除一个以外的每个 Action 应用一个 Action 过滤器。我该怎么办?

例如,假设我想对除允许用户登录的操作之外的每个操作应用授权过滤器。

提前致谢.....

最佳答案

从 asp.net mvc 3 开始,您现在可以通过实现 the IFilterProvider interface 来应用条件过滤器.您可以在 Phil Haack's blog 上找到几乎完全符合您要求的示例。 .

关于asp.net-mvc - 操作过滤器异常,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6001821/

相关文章:

c# - Asp.net mvc 项目发布后出现内部服务器错误

c# - 在代码中的 StringLengthAttribute 上设置 MaximumLength

asp.net-mvc-3 - 在嵌入式 MongoDB 文档中强制生成新的 _id

c# - 使用 Azure 存储存储媒体文件

asp.net-mvc - 无法在 Entity Framework 模型中的 MVC 4 模板中使用 UserProfile?

javascript - Knockout.js 删除不适用于主视图模型中的嵌套 View 模型和 View 模型

mysql - ASP.NET 应用程序显示 MySQL 中存储的日期之前的日期

c# - 如何在 ASP.NET MVC3 中通过 HTTPS 提供静态文件(在 ~/Content 中)

asp.net-mvc - 在 ASP.NET MVC 上使用绝对路径访问 View

jquery - 对隐藏字段执行验证